The level of precision can be enhanced through upgrades in both hardware and software. In 1987, a tool-making company upgraded its equipment to include the ability to look further ahead and anticipate tool movement. It could predict the tool movement and make changes up to 1,000 lines of point data. This enhanced accuracy and efficiency. CNC machines can make even more precise parts in the same time frame. To improve the precision of CNC machining, companies can use laser measurements, and other advanced methods.

The benefits of CNC machining extend beyond just precision. It enables designers to create complex shapes that would otherwise be impossible to achieve using conventional manufacturing processes. Because the machine is scalable, retooling a manufacturing plant will be unnecessary. Additionally, short-run production runs can be easily replicated. The cost of CNC machining can vary from one machine to the next depending on the size and complexity of the project. It can increase the production time of a product, especially when machining features with tight tolerances. This is especially true for internal surfaces. 

The cost of CNC machining depends on the materials that are used. The higher the quality of the parts, the more expensive the CNC machining process will be. In contrast, cheaper materials may require less time and less expensive tools. CNC machining requires multiple steps and operations until the finished product is ready for production. However, the cost per piece decreases if the parts are the same. As a result, a single prototype sample must be allocated for the entire cost, while a large batch of the same part can be assigned to a single piece.
